在Antd中,可以使用width
属性来设置表格的列宽。以下是一个示例代码,演示如何解决Antd表格列宽问题:
import React from "react";
import { Table } from "antd";
const data = [
{
key: "1",
name: "John",
age: 32,
address: "New York",
},
{
key: "2",
name: "Mike",
age: 25,
address: "London",
},
{
key: "3",
name: "Anna",
age: 28,
address: "Paris",
},
];
const columns = [
{
title: "Name",
dataIndex: "name",
key: "name",
width: 150, // 设置列宽为150px
},
{
title: "Age",
dataIndex: "age",
key: "age",
width: 100, // 设置列宽为100px
},
{
title: "Address",
dataIndex: "address",
key: "address",
width: 200, // 设置列宽为200px
},
];
const App = () => {
return
;
};
export default App;
在上面的代码中,我们在columns
数组中的每个列对象中添加了width
属性来设置列宽。可以根据具体需求调整每列的宽度值,单位为像素(px)。
下一篇:Antd表格内如何添加子标题?